Default 2004 Ram 1500 4.7 overheating

I have read a lot of threads on this subject but have some specific questions still.
When it overheats top hose is hot , radiator and bottom hose cool. i took out the thermostat and just replaced the water pump. if i put a water hose in top hose water runs out bottom hose.

most likely have / had head leaking into exhaust . used some head sealant

read about getting bubbles out - why would this cause overheating ( not possible if head still leaking)

was told by one mechanic who knows these 4.7 that he wont do head job on them ( they come back to bite Him) , just replaces it.

next step is to replace radiator or engine ?

Any wisdom appreciated

Fix the head gasket correctly. Sealant is bad news. Sealers can plug up stuff you don't want it to.
